H.Con.Res. 61: Directing the President, pursuant to section 5(c) of the War Powers Resolution, to remove United States Armed Forces from hostilities with presidentially designated terrorist organizations in the Western Hemisphere.

A House concurrent resolution (H.Con.Res.) in the 119th U.S. Congress.

Overview

Congress119th U.S. Congress (2025–2026)
TypeHouse concurrent resolution (H.Con.Res.)
Originating chamberHouse
Cosponsors0
Latest action2025-12-17 —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ection.
Last updated2025-12-19
